Going Green: Adding Vegetables
Don’t shy away from vegetables when crafting your papaya smoothie. Spinach is a phenomenal choice. It may sound unusual, but blending spinach with papaya not only adds nutrition but also enhances the smoothie’s vibrant color. Spinach is mild in flavor and won’t overpower the papaya, making it an ideal green addition. You’ll benefit from the iron and vitamins that spinach brings, making this smoothie a nutrient powerhouse. Kale is another green that can be introduced into the mix. With its slightly earthy flavor, it’s best to blend it with sweeter fruits to mask any bitterness, and with papaya, it can work wonders!
Liquid Base: Choosing the Right Liquid
The liquid base you choose can significantly alter the texture and taste of your smoothie. Coconut water is a fantastic option, especially for those looking to amplify the tropical vibes. It hydrates while adding a subtle sweetness, making it a refreshing choice for your papaya and fruit blend. Alternatively, almond milk provides a nutty undertone, creating a creamier texture without overpowering the delicate flavors of papaya. If you prefer a richer smoothie, try using yogurt as your base. The creaminess of yogurt not only improves the texture but also adds probiotics, which are great for digestion.

Nuts and Seeds: Boosting the Nutritional Value
Incorporating nuts and seeds can significantly bolster the nutritional profile of your papaya smoothie. Chia seeds are an excellent addition; they not only provide omega-3 fatty acids but also enhance the smoothie’s texture by adding a slight thickness once blended. Almonds or cashews can also be ground into your smoothie, providing healthy fats and protein, which are crucial for sustained energy throughout the day. Flaxseeds are another nutritious option. They offer a nutty flavor and are packed with fiber and essential nutrients, making your smoothie not just a treat but also a health boost.

Making It a Meal
If you’re looking to turn your papaya smoothie into a complete meal, consider adding oats or protein powder. Oats provide a wholesome dimension to your smoothie, keeping you satiated for hours. Choose rolled oats for smooth blending or quick oats for convenience. A scoop of your favorite protein powder can amp up the nutritional value, providing the necessary energy to fuel your day. When combined with papaya and other mixers, you’ll have a nourishing meal in a glass that’s perfect for breakfast or an on-the-go lunch.
